Hummingbird Resources Plc is listed in the Gold Ores s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ker HUM. The last closing price for Hummingbird Resources was 9p. Over the last year, Hummingbird Resources shares have traded in a share price range of 4.10p to 14.00p.

Hummingbird Resources currently has 601,918,700 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Hummingbird Resources is £54.17 million. Hummingbird Resources has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of -1.54.

Hum are due to release more news this month.

"Following the successful 2018 exploration drilling campaign the Company, as previously stated, is currently updating its Reserve and Resource statements which are due by the end of Q2 2019.

... the Company is currently updating its LoM plan. At present, this was last forecast as part of the DFS in 2016 and showed that the Yanfolila Gold Mine would average 107,000oz gold production per year. The current draft LoM plan, awaiting finalisation, indicates that in the upcoming 3 years (2020-2022) the Company is able to achieve production of 130,000-145,000oz per year at a targeted AISC of US$800/oz. The Company is pleased to report that the early estimates from the LoM plan showed a significant improvement on production levels and lowering cost base of the mine.

From 2023 the average annual production from Reserves reduces to 80,000oz per year. The Company intends to announce the results of scoping studies on both the Gonka deposit, 5km from the process plant, and underground mining at Komana East (currently operating open pit). The studies will, when converted to Reserves following feasibility study completion, augment the existing Reserves to increase annual production and extend the mine life further. Based on current Resources over 1Moz gold sits outside of Reserves"

"The second ball mill will augment the existing process plant by increasing throughput capacity from 1Mtpa to 1.24Mtpa when operating at 100% fresh ore and from 1.2Mtpa to 1.4Mtpa when processing a blend of ore types
Commissioning of the completed mill due to start in July with full capacity ore throughput expected in August 2019"

Will further help the AISC figures for this year, and full year effect in 2020
